Why does my goal say “off-track”?

Our automated advice tools continuously track portfolio performance for each of your goals, and we’ll indicate whether you will reach your goal’s target amount if there is average market performance. Your portfolio performance is categorized as either “On-Track” or “Off-Track” depending on whether you are likely to reach your target or not.

Portfolio performance is “Off-Track” when the projected value of your portfolio in the future—the current balance plus future contributions plus investment growth—is not sufficient to reach the target amount assuming average market performance.

If your goal is “off-track,” we’ll provide advice for bringing the goal back on track. This could mean either increasing the amount of future monthly contributions, increasing the term to make it longer, or increasing the current balance in the account by making a one-time deposit.
